STATUS
• National GHG Inventory: Estimation of GHG Emission and Removal from all sectors have been completed and being reviewed by international experts and related sectors.
• Mitigation Analysis: Analysis of mitigation nearly completed and will be submitted to related sector for review by the end of September
• V&A Assessment: Still in progress and first draft of report • V&A Assessment: Still in progress and first draft of report
will be ready for review by end of September
• Other chapters: Still in progress and first draft of report will be ready for review by end of September
• Public Consultation (National Workshop) is expected by mid of October

Barriers
• There is no comprehensive assessment so far conducted by sectors related to the constraint, gaps and related financial and capacity needs to achieve the objective of the
convention. Many of policies and program being developed are not intended for addressing climate change
• Some sectors still see that SNC is environmental issues and it is the responsibility of MoE ~ no budget being allocated by it is the responsibility of MoE ~ no budget being allocated by sector to support the member of the WG in the process of developing the SNC.
– Need for institutionalizing the process of developing future national communication under the UNFCCC ~ may need the government regulation on this
